Fiddler's Tune-book
Peter Kennedy

First published in the early 1950s and now re-printed with chords, The Fiddler's Tune-Book was a landmark collection, edited by veteran folklorist and collector Peter Kennedy. This book is crammed with 200 core repertoire tunes for all traditional musicians. If you have no traditional music books, this is the first one you should buy.

Accompanying Irish Music on Guitar Book
Frank Kilkelly

Frank Kilkelly has designed this book for guitarists who want to understand how to accompany Irish music. Frank assumes an understanding of the guitar but no knowledge of Irish music. He delves into DADGAD, dropped D and double dropped D tunings.

The Irish Concertina Book
Mick Bramich

Mick Bramich presents a systematic approach to playing the Anglo concertina, Irish style. His method is one of the most efficient ways of exploiting the peculiar nuances of this instrument. Keys are taken in order of difficulty and all types of tunes are tackled.
